innovation is not exactly being new but being new about something else,,to innovate is to improve something that already exists by making it better for reasons that normally stand commercial, an innovation is directed to make society better, when one makes use of the innovation, they should have their needs satisfied since they have to pay for it in the first place...well take a look at the BMW in the 1970's and the innovated version of 2010, very big difference but the same brand, simply innovated, it is important to note that evolution is also a process and it just keeps growing in people's minds,

NOVELTY

being new means being fresh and without any pre-usage but do we really know the 'quality of being new''?
when any of us has a new idea, the only reason we hold on to it is because we think we are the first ones to have it, we think it is a new idea into being, what we are holding on to is the quality of its being new in our minds, such misconceptions change after we realize we are not the first ones to have such ideas, ''novelty' is what helps us tell the difference between being ''new'' and the ''quality of being new''..
